25th Anniversary Ramble - 18th February
In February 1987 the first St Edmund's ramble took place - it was a walk
in the Washburn Valley. This February we intend to celebrate the anniversary
by undertaking a ramble in the same area although not following the exact
route of the original walk.
This year's walk will be 5¼ miles in length and will start from the
Blubberhouses car park and follow the River Washburn up to Thruscross Reservoir.
After following the shore of the reservoir for around half a mile we will
head south and then east back to the car park.
Afterwards we plan to drive to the Sun Inn at Norwood (on the B6451 Otley
to Dacre road) for lunch.
